North Carolina's humid subtropical climate, marked by warm, moist summers and mild winters, necessitates countertop materials that resist moisture and staining. Corian countertops are an excellent choice for kitchens in Raleigh, offering a non-porous surface that inhibits the growth of mold and mildew, common concerns in humid environments. The material's inherent stability also ensures it will not be adversely affected by the typical temperature and humidity fluctuations experienced throughout the state, providing a reliable and low-maintenance option.
When seeking Corian countertop installation services in the Raleigh area, it is essential to engage with providers who are knowledgeable about North Carolina's building codes and licensing requirements. Expertise in proper substrate preparation, the precise application of adhesives suitable for solid surfaces, and the correct installation of expansion joints to accommodate environmental changes are critical for ensuring long-term durability and aesthetic appeal. Thoroughly vetting contractors for their experience with solid surface fabrication and installation within the diverse architectural landscape of Raleigh will yield a superior result for your kitchen renovation.
